How Casino Games Work: Overview and Types
Traditional Slot Games
Traditional slot games, whether classic or modern, operate on the principles of probability and RNGs. Classic slots feature few reels and paylines, while modern slots include multiple reels, paylines, and bonuses[2]. Progressive slots, a variant of modern slots, accumulate a portion of each bet towards a growing jackpot, which can be won through specific combinations or at random[1].
Progressive Slot Mechanics:
- Standalone Progressive Slots: These are linked to a single machine, offering smaller jackpots.
- Local Progressive Slots: Jackpots are shared across machines within the same casino.
- Wide Area Progressive Slots: Jackpots are shared across multiple casinos, offering the largest prizes[2].

Delving into Game Strategies and Odds
Understanding Slot Strategies
Despite the random nature of slots, players often seek strategies to improve their odds. Key strategies include:
- Choosing High RTP Games: Games with higher Return to Player (RTP) percentages provide better long-term returns.
- Bankroll Management: Setting and adhering to a budget is crucial to avoid significant financial losses.
- Understanding Volatility: Low volatility games offer more frequent, smaller payouts, while high volatility games yield larger but less frequent wins[3].

The Appeal of Progressive Jackpots
Progressive jackpots have become a significant draw in the online casino world. These jackpots grow incrementally with each bet placed on a linked game across multiple casinos. The appeal lies in the potential for life-changing wins, as these jackpots can reach millions of dollars.
How Progressive Jackpots Work
- Contributions: A small percentage of each qualifying bet is added to the jackpot pool.
- Winning Conditions: Jackpots can be won through specific symbol combinations or randomly through an RNG[1].
- Reset Mechanism: Once a jackpot is won, it resets to a seeded amount.
Odds of Winning Progressive Jackpots
While progressive jackpots offer the potential for massive payouts, the odds of winning can be extremely low, often in the millions to one[1]. This makes them akin to lottery games, where winning is largely based on luck.
